The locality of Kara-Oba in Kazakhstan has produced some very attractive Ferberite specimens over the years. This piece is a very aesthetic crystal group featuring sharp, bladed, striated blades of Ferberite measuring up to 1.4 cm which are associated with sparkling cubic Pyrite crystals and even one small pale green Fluorite cube. A great association piece and a nice miniature specimen from this well known locality in central Kazakhstan.
